[svn r219] Fixed: the tango/lib/gc/basic garbage collector now compiles and links into an executable (change in tango/lib/llvmdc-posix.mak), closes #5 . Changed: removed the crappy realloc based dynamic memory runtime and started moving over to DMD style runtime support, part of moving to real GC. Fixed: dynamic arrays now use GC runtime for allocating memory. Fixed: new expression now use GC for allocating memory. Changed: revamped the dynamic array support routines related to dynamic memory. Fixed: assertions no longer create exsessive allocas. Changed: misc. minor cleanups.

+module tangotests.mem1;
+
+import tango.stdc.stdio;
+
+void main()
+{
+    printf("new int;\n");
+    int* i = new int;
+    assert(*i == 0);
+
+    printf("new int[3];\n");
+    int[] ar = new int[3];
+    ar[0] = 1;
+    ar[1] = 56;
+    assert(ar.length == 3);
+    assert(ar[0] == 1);
+    assert(ar[1] == 56);
+    assert(ar[2] == 0);
+
+    printf("array ~= elem;\n");
+    int[] ar2;
+    ar2 ~= 22;
+    assert(ar2.length == 1);
+    assert(ar2[0] == 22);
+
+    printf("array ~= array;\n");
+    ar2 ~= ar;
+    assert(ar2.length == 4);
+    assert(ar2[0] == 22);
+    assert(ar2[1] == 1);
+    printf("%d %d %d %d\n", ar2[0], ar2[1], ar2[2], ar2[3]);
+    assert(ar2[2] == 56);
+    assert(ar2[3] == 0);
+
+    printf("array ~ array;\n");
+    int[] ar5 = ar ~ ar2;
+    assert(ar5.length == 7);
+    assert(ar5[0] == 1);
+    assert(ar5[1] == 56);
+    assert(ar5[2] == 0);
+    assert(ar5[3] == 22);
+    assert(ar5[4] == 1);
+    assert(ar5[5] == 56);
+    assert(ar5[6] == 0);
+
+    printf("array ~ elem;\n");
+    int[] ar4 = ar2 ~ 123;
+    assert(ar4.length == 5);
+    assert(ar4[0] == 22);
+    assert(ar4[1] == 1);
+    assert(ar4[2] == 56);
+    assert(ar4[3] == 0);
+    assert(ar4[4] == 123);
+
+    printf("elem ~ array;\n");
+    int[] ar3 = 123 ~ ar2;
+    assert(ar3.length == 5);
+    assert(ar3[0] == 123);
+    assert(ar3[1] == 22);
+    assert(ar3[2] == 1);
+    assert(ar3[3] == 56);
+    assert(ar3[4] == 0);
+}
